如何制定增量同步方案?确保数据传输安全性的措施

阅读人数:52预计阅读时长:5 min

在这个数据驱动的时代,企业面临着巨大的挑战:如何确保在海量数据中保持高效的增量同步,同时不牺牲数据传输的安全性?随着数据量的急剧增加,传统的批量同步方法显得笨重且不灵活。企业需要一种能够实时处理数据变化的增量同步方案,以确保业务的连续性和数据的完整性。本文将揭示如何制定高效的增量同步方案,并探讨确保数据传输安全性的最佳措施。

如何制定增量同步方案?确保数据传输安全性的措施

🌟 一、了解增量同步方案的基础

1. 增量同步的概念与重要性

增量同步指的是仅同步变化的数据,而不是每次同步整个数据集。这种方法不仅可以减少数据传输量,还能提高同步效率。增量同步在数据仓库管理和实时分析中尤为重要,因为它可以显著降低数据冗余和网络负担。

为什么增量同步如此重要?

  • 效率提高:只传输变化的数据意味着减少了网络带宽的消耗。
  • 实时性:能够快速响应数据变化,支持实时分析和决策。
  • 降低成本:减少存储和计算资源的占用。

2. 制定增量同步方案的关键步骤

制定一个有效的增量同步方案需要关注以下几个方面:

  • 识别数据变化:通过日志扫描或变更数据捕获(CDC)技术,识别数据的增量变化。
  • 选择合适的工具:使用能够支持增量同步的工具,如FineDataLink,以简化同步过程。
  • 优化网络传输:确保网络的稳定性和速度,以支持高效的数据传输。
  • 监控与调整:持续监控同步过程,并根据实际情况进行调整。
步骤 描述 优势
识别数据变化 使用CDC技术识别数据库中的变化 提高数据识别的准确性
选择合适的工具 使用低代码工具(如FDL)进行同步任务配置 降低开发和维护成本
优化网络传输 使用先进的网络协议和压缩技术 提高传输速度和稳定性
监控与调整 实时监控同步过程,及时发现并解决问题 提高系统的响应速度和可靠性

3. 增量同步方案的常见挑战

尽管增量同步有许多优势,但实施过程中仍然面临以下挑战:

数据安全

  • 数据完整性:确保同步的数据在源和目标数据库中始终保持一致。
  • 系统复杂性:复杂的数据结构可能导致同步任务配置和管理的困难。
  • 安全性:在传输过程中保护敏感数据免受攻击。

解决这些挑战需要系统化的策略和工具支持,FineDataLink提供了一种低代码的解决方案,可以帮助简化增量同步的配置和管理过程。


🔒 二、确保数据传输安全性的措施

1. 数据安全的必要性与风险

在数据传输过程中,安全性是一个不容忽视的因素。数据泄露或篡改可能导致严重的商业损失和法律后果。随着数据合规性要求的增加,企业必须确保他们的数据传输符合相关法规。

数据传输风险包括:

  • 数据泄露:未经授权的访问可能导致敏感信息的泄露。
  • 数据篡改:在传输过程中,数据可能被恶意修改。
  • 合规风险:未能遵守数据保护法律法规可能导致法律责任。

2. 实施安全传输的最佳实践

为了确保数据在传输过程中保持安全,企业可以采取以下措施:

  • 加密数据传输:使用SSL/TLS协议进行加密,以保护数据在传输过程中的安全。
  • 身份验证:确保只有经过授权的用户和系统才能访问数据。
  • 访问控制:使用角色访问控制(RBAC)来限制数据访问权限。
  • 审计和监控:持续监控数据传输过程,记录异常活动。
措施 描述 优势
加密数据传输 使用SSL/TLS协议进行数据加密 防止数据泄露
身份验证 使用多因素认证确保数据访问的安全性 提高安全性并防止未授权访问
访问控制 实施RBAC限制数据访问权限 减少数据泄露的可能性
审计和监控 实时记录并监控数据传输过程中的异常活动 快速响应潜在的安全威胁

3. 安全传输措施的实施挑战

尽管安全措施能够有效保护数据传输,但实施过程中仍然存在以下挑战:

  • 性能与安全的平衡:加密和身份验证可能影响传输速度和性能。
  • 复杂的配置和管理:安全措施的配置可能需要额外的资源和专业知识。
  • 不断变化的威胁:需要持续更新安全策略以应对新的安全威胁。

借助FineDataLink等工具,企业可以简化安全措施的实施和管理过程,确保数据同步和传输的安全性。


📈 三、实践案例与解决方案推荐

1. 实际案例分析

在某大型零售企业中,数据同步一直是运营中的痛点。传统的批量同步模式导致了网络拥堵和数据延迟,影响了实时库存管理和客户服务。通过实施增量同步方案,并结合FineDataLink平台,该企业成功实现了数据的高效实时同步。

案例要点:

  • 背景:企业需要实时更新库存数据以支持在线销售。
  • 挑战:传统同步方式导致数据延迟,影响业务决策。
  • 解决方案:通过FineDataLink实现增量同步,优化数据传输。

2. FineDataLink的优势

FineDataLink作为一款国产的低代码ETL工具,提供了一站式解决方案,帮助企业简化数据同步和安全措施的实施:

  • 低代码平台:简化数据同步任务的配置和管理。
  • 实时同步支持:提供高效的增量同步能力,支持复杂的数据集成场景。
  • 安全传输功能:内置数据加密和访问控制功能,确保数据传输的安全性。

推荐体验: FineDataLink体验Demo

3. 未来发展与趋势

随着技术的不断发展,增量同步和数据安全将继续成为企业数据管理的重点。企业需要不断调整和优化他们的同步方案,以应对快速变化的市场需求和技术趋势。

  • 自动化与智能化:未来的数据同步方案将更加依赖自动化和智能化技术,以提高效率和安全性。
  • 混合云环境:随着云技术的发展,企业需要考虑在混合云环境中实施数据同步和安全策略。
  • 数据隐私与合规性:数据保护法律法规的变化将影响企业的数据管理策略。

在制定增量同步方案和实施数据传输安全措施时,企业应结合实际需求和技术发展趋势,以实现业务的持续增长和数据的安全保护。


🏁 总结

增量同步方案和数据传输安全性是企业数据管理中的两个重要方面。通过识别数据变化、选择合适工具、优化传输以及实施安全措施,企业可以实现高效的数据同步和安全保护。FineDataLink作为国产低代码ETL工具,为企业提供了一站式解决方案,简化了同步和安全措施的实施。在未来,企业需要不断优化增量同步方案和安全策略,以应对技术和市场的发展变化。


引用文献:

数据同步

  1. 《大数据时代的数据管理与分析》,作者:李华,出版社:电子工业出版社,2019。
  2. 《数据库系统概念与应用》,作者:张伟,出版社:清华大学出版社,2020。
  3. 《信息安全技术与实践》,作者:王强,出版社:人民邮电出版社,2021。

    本文相关FAQs

🤔 如何选择适合的增量同步方案来应对公司庞大的数据量?

老板要求我们在不影响现有业务的情况下,实现高效的增量同步。公司数据库庞大,数据量还在不断增长,传统的批量同步方法已经捉襟见肘。有没有大佬能分享一下选择增量同步方案的经验?具体需要考虑哪些方面?


在选择增量同步方案时,首先要明确业务需求和技术限制。你的目标是实现高效、稳定且实时的数据同步,以支持公司业务的正常运作。为此,需要考虑以下几个关键因素:

  1. 数据变化频率:了解数据更新的频率是选择增量同步方案的基础。一些数据可能只在特定时间段内有变动,而另一些则需要实时跟踪。这将影响你选择是接近实时的同步方式还是定时批量同步。
  2. 数据安全性:数据在传输过程中可能面临多种安全威胁,因此需要确保传输通道的加密和认证措施到位。TLS/SSL加密是常见的选择,此外还需考虑如何对数据进行访问控制。
  3. 系统兼容性:确保所选的增量同步工具能与现有的系统架构和数据库类型兼容。不同数据库的日志结构不同,这可能影响到增量同步的实现。
  4. 性能要求:同步工具的性能对整体方案的可行性有重大影响。需要评估工具的处理速度、资源消耗以及对现有系统性能的影响。
  5. 可扩展性:随着数据量的增加,系统需要具备扩展能力。选择一个能够轻松扩展的方案,以便未来应对更多的数据和更复杂的业务需求。
  6. 易用性和可维护性:一个高效的方案不仅要能快速实施,还要易于维护和管理。低代码平台如FineDataLink可以帮助简化操作流程,降低维护成本。
  7. 成本效益:最后,方案的选择还需考虑到预算和成本效益。在满足业务需求的前提下,尽量选择性价比高的方案。

通过综合考虑以上因素,企业可以制定出适合自身需求的增量同步方案。FineDataLink作为一款低代码、高时效的数据集成平台,在这些方面提供了全面的支持,其便捷的配置和强大的功能为企业的数据传输和管理提供了更高效的解决方案。 FineDataLink体验Demo 可以帮助企业更好地理解和应用这一工具。


🔒 数据传输过程中如何确保安全性?

我们在实施数据增量同步的时候,总是担心数据在传输过程中被拦截或篡改。公司内部对数据安全有严格的要求,有没有什么措施可以确保数据在传输过程中的安全性?


数据传输安全性是企业在进行数据同步和集成时必须考虑的核心问题。保护数据免受窃听、篡改以及未经授权的访问,是确保企业信息安全的基础。以下是一些常见且有效的数据传输安全措施:

  1. 加密传输:使用TLS/SSL协议加密数据传输,以防止数据在网络中被拦截和读取。加密能够有效保护敏感信息在传输中的安全性,是现代数据传输的标准做法。
  2. 身份验证:在访问数据之前进行严格的身份验证,以确保只有经过授权的用户和设备才可以访问数据。这可以通过双因素认证或基于角色的访问控制(RBAC)来实现。
  3. 网络隔离:通过设置防火墙和虚拟专用网络(VPN),可以有效地隔离和保护网络环境,防止未经授权的访问。
  4. 数据完整性检查:使用哈希函数和数字签名来验证数据在传输过程中的完整性,确保数据未被篡改。
  5. 安全日志审计:记录和监控所有数据传输活动,便于追踪和分析任何可疑的安全事件。这种措施对于检测和响应潜在的安全威胁是至关重要的。
  6. 定期安全评估:定期进行安全评估和漏洞扫描,以识别和修复系统中的安全漏洞。确保系统始终保持在最佳的安全状态。
  7. 合规性检查:遵循行业标准和法规,如GDPR、HIPAA等,确保数据处理和传输符合法律要求。

通过实施上述安全措施,企业可以大幅提升数据传输过程中的安全性,保护敏感信息免受各种潜在威胁的侵害。这不仅能帮助企业满足内外部的合规要求,还能增强客户对公司数据安全的信任。


🛠️ 如何优化现有数据同步流程以提升性能?

我们的数据同步流程已经运行了一段时间,但随着业务的扩展,性能瓶颈越来越明显。有没有优化现有数据同步流程的方法,或者是否需要引入新的工具?


优化数据同步流程是提高企业数据处理能力的一个重要步骤,尤其是在数据量持续增长的情况下。以下是一些优化现有数据同步流程的方法,以及引入新工具的建议:

  1. 分析瓶颈:首先要对现有流程进行详细的性能分析,找出瓶颈所在。这通常包括数据库查询效率、网络带宽限制、同步工具的性能等方面的问题。
  2. 调整同步策略:根据数据变化的特点,调整同步策略。例如,对于变化频繁的数据,采用接近实时的增量同步方式,而对于变化较少的数据,可以使用批量同步。
  3. 优化数据库查询:确保数据同步过程中涉及的数据库查询是经过优化的。使用索引、避免全表扫描、减少不必要的数据处理等都是常见的优化方法。
  4. 并行处理:通过并行处理来提高同步速度。多线程或分布式处理可以显著加快数据同步的效率。
  5. 压缩和批量传输:使用数据压缩技术减少传输数据量,并通过批量传输来降低网络通信的开销。
  6. 定期清理:定期清理和归档不再需要的数据,以减少系统负担,提升整体性能。
  7. 引入新工具:如果现有的工具无法满足需求,可以考虑引入新的数据集成工具。FineDataLink(FDL)作为一款低代码、高时效的数据集成平台,可以提供灵活的配置和强大的性能支持,为企业提供一站式的数据同步和管理解决方案。 FineDataLink体验Demo 可以帮助企业更好地理解和应用这一工具。

通过以上方法,企业可以有效提升数据同步流程的性能,确保在数据量不断增长的情况下,依然能够高效、稳定地进行数据处理。这不仅能支持企业的业务扩展,还能提升整体的数据管理水平。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for dash分析喵
dash分析喵

文章的步骤解释得很清楚,尤其是增量同步的部分。我正计划在我们的应用中实现类似的功能,非常有帮助!

2025年7月22日
点赞
赞 (71)
Avatar for fineBI逻辑星
fineBI逻辑星

关于数据传输安全性,文章提到的加密措施很有启发。我想知道在跨云平台同步时,是否有更具体的安全建议?

2025年7月22日
点赞
赞 (29)
电话咨询图标电话咨询icon产品激活iconicon在线咨询